This volume investigates the fundamental principles of physics, specifically focusing on electromagnetism, optics, and modern physics concepts. Randall D. Knight, a professor emeritus of physics, utilizes a research-based pedagogical approach to bridge the gap between conceptual understanding and mathematical application. The text employs a structured framework that emphasizes problem-solving strategies and the development of physical intuition through clear, logical progression.
What You Will Find
Educators frequently cite this text for its clarity and its focus on active learning techniques that assist students in mastering complex physical laws. It is widely recognized as a foundational resource for undergraduate physics curricula due to its rigorous yet accessible presentation of technical material.
